Компания международный издатель онлайн-игр, занимающий лидирующие позиции в России и странах СНГ. Мы с 2007 года успешно развиваем собственную игровую платформу, на которой опубликованы такие легенды, как Lineage II, Aion, Ragnarok Prime Online. А ещё мы ежегодно запускаем новые проекты, в их числе - Gran Saga, BnS NEO и другие.
Сейчас мы ищем Backend Tech Lead для развития технологической платформы холдинга, объединяющей несколько продуктовых направлений в рамках единой экосистемы: игровую платформу, игровые серверы, мобильные приложения, online- и offline-магазины.
Проект активно развивается: растет количество пользователей, интеграций, требований к надежности, производительности, наблюдаемости и скорости поставки изменений.
Нам нужен сильный технический лидер, который сможет проектировать архитектуру backend-систем, развивать engineering-практики, быть hands-on в сложных задачах и помогать команде принимать качественные технические решения.
Обязанности:
-
Отвечать за направление backend: планировать работу, декомпозировать задачи, помогать разработчикам расти и отвечать за технический результат команды.
-
Проектировать архитектуру backend-сервисов и платформенных компонентов: API, интеграции, фоновые процессы, очереди, хранилища, контракты.
-
Участвовать hands-on в разработке сложных и критичных частей системы
Проводить code review и design review, повышать качество архитектуры, кода и технических решений.
-
Развивать инженерные процессы: release readiness, Definition of Done, ownership, документацию, снижение bus factor, работу с техническим долгом.
-
Повышать надежность production-систем: observability, метрики, алерты, отказоустойчивость, обработка ошибок, retries, timeouts, idempotency.
-
Взаимодействовать с продуктом, бизнесом и смежными командами, помогая переводить бизнес-задачи в понятные технические решения.
-
Внедрять и развивать практики AI-driven development.
-
Коммерческий опыт разработки на C# / .NET от 7 лет.
-
Опыт работы с ASP.NET Core, Web API, background services, hosted services.
-
Опыт проектирования backend-архитектуры для высоконагруженных и распределенных систем.
-
Понимание архитектурных паттернов и подходов: layered architecture, clean architecture, modular monolith, microservices, event-driven architecture, CQRS, eventual consistency.
-
Понимание принципов надежной интеграции сервисов: retries, exponential backoff, timeouts, circuit breaker, idempotency, graceful degradation, health checks.
-
Глубокое понимание ООП, SOLID, паттернов проектирования и инженерных практик написания поддерживаемого кода.
-
Уверенное знание PostgreSQL: индексы, транзакции, блокировки, оптимизация запросов, работа с большими объемами данных.
-
Опыт работы с Redis: кеширование, TTL, session/state storage, distributed locks.
-
Опыт с message brokers: Kafka, RabbitMQ или аналогичные решения.
-
Опыт работы с Docker и Kubernetes.
-
Понимание CI/CD, GitLab CI/CD, branching models, release flow.
-
Умение выстраивать инженерные стандарты: code review, design review, техническая документация, ownership, quality gates.
-
Интерес к AI-driven development и готовность применять AI-инструменты как часть современного engineering-процесса.
-
Способность разбираться в бизнес-контексте задачи, а не только в технической реализации.
-
Готовность быть hands-on: самостоятельно разбираться в коде, писать production-код, помогать команде в сложных технических задачах.
-
Опыт разработки desktop-приложений на C# / .NET., в т.ч. понимание архитектуры приложений, где web-интерфейс работает внутри native shell.
- Официальное оформление по ТК РФ (аккредитованная IT компания).
- График работы: понедельник-пятница, 10:00 - 19:00.
- Социальный пакет (добровольное медицинское страхование, страхование жизни, возможность застраховать родственников).
- Оплачиваемые sick days.
- Возможность профессионального обучения (программа индивидуального развития, оплата конференций, семинаров и т.д.).
- Обучение иностранным языкам.
- Корпоративная онлайн библиотека на базе Литрес.
- Корпоративные праздники с выездом за город.
Похожие вакансии
Опыт работы в DevOps от 4 лет (Docker, Helm, Jenkins / GitLab CI, Python). Опыт администрирования Kubernetes от 2 лет.
Опыт работы с ключевыми клиентами рынка HoReCa (региональные и федеральные сети, производства готовой еды, фабрики кухни, крупные и сетевые Отели...
Опыт от 3 лет в роли Product Owner / Product Manager в IT, data-driven подход. Умение определять видение продукта, его...
Глубокие знания и практический опыт внедрения и поддержки систем антивирусной защиты, EDR, MTA. Глубокие знания и практический опыт внедрения и...
Высшее техническое образование. Опыт работы в проектировании автоматики и диспетчеризации инженерных систем зданий - от 3 лет. Приветствуется опыт работы в...
